Complete jQuery Tutorials with Applications

Course Description

A complete series of 200 video tutorials by Alex Garrett from phpacademy, introducing basic and advanced concepts of jQuery from start to finish. This series covers not only basic syntax for jQuery, but many useful functionalities used on websites, such as: Online users counter, DIV that runs down the page, AJAX content loading, Emoticons in textareas, show/hide text fields, dragging and dropping, email form validation, and many more.

Whether you are a complete beginner to jQuery and Javascript, or an experienced developer, this series will have something to offer you.

Complete jQuery Tutorials with Applications
Not yet rated

Video Lectures & Study Materials

# Lecture Play Lecture
1 Introduction to jQuery (6:55) Play Video
2 An Example (3:52) Play Video
3 Implementing jQuery (6:37) Play Video
4 Testing jQuery (3:07) Play Video
5 Inline/External Scripting (5:33) Play Video
6 Document Ready Event (6:09) Play Video
7 Ready (4:36) Play Video
8 Load (8:23) Play Video
9 Window Load (4:51) Play Video
10 Window Unload (7:07) Play Video
11 Introduction to Selectors (2:06) Play Video
12 All selector (5:04) Play Video
13 ID selector (5:53) Play Video
14 Element selector (5:44) Play Video
15 Submit selector (6:04) Play Video
16 Text selector (5:44) Play Video
17 A selector example with CSS (3:37) Play Video
18 Multiple selectors (6:25) Play Video
19 This selector (6:23) Play Video
20 Even/odd selectors (7:36) Play Video
21 Attribute selectors (6:40) Play Video
22 Attribute selectors (6:17) Play Video
23 Contains selector (4:41) Play Video
24 Contains selector (4:56) Play Video
25 Basic form field selection (4:35) Play Video
26 Basic form field selection (4:34) Play Video
27 Font size switcher (5:21) Play Video
28 Font size switcher (5:29) Play Video
29 Enable submit button after file selected (6:27) Play Video
30 Enable submit button after file selected (6:57) Play Video
31 Click (7:29) Play Video
32 Double click (5:04) Play Video
33 Key up/down (8:43) Play Video
34 Change (6:32) Play Video
35 Submit (8:26) Play Video
36 Toggle (5:32) Play Video
37 Hover (5:37) Play Video
38 Scroll (5:13) Play Video
39 Select (4:22) Play Video
40 Focus in (5:39) Play Video
41 Focus out (3:11) Play Video
42 Bind (9:14) Play Video
43 Live (4:55) Play Video
44 Live (4:41) Play Video
45 Character Counting Remaining on Textarea (5:15) Play Video
46 Character Counting Remaining on Textarea (4:56) Play Video
47 Hide/Show a DIV (8:47) Play Video
48 Hover over description (6:21) Play Video
49 Hover over description (6:20) Play Video
50 Hover over description (7:06) Play Video
51 Hover over description (7:06) Play Video
52 html (5:29) Play Video
53 val (6:50) Play Video
54 attr (4:47) Play Video
55 addClass (4:46) Play Video
56 removeClass (5:33) Play Video
57 toggleClass (4:36) Play Video
58 removeAttr (4:42) Play Video
59 removeAttr (4:51) Play Video
60 each (6:37) Play Video
61 each (6:21) Play Video
62 next/nextAll and prev/prevAll (7:16) Play Video
63 next/nextAll and prev/prevAll (6:55) Play Video
64 find (5:09) Play Video
65 has (6:17) Play Video
66 Hide (6:36) Play Video
67 Show (3:38) Play Video
68 Fade In (6:00) Play Video
69 Fade Out (5:13) Play Video
70 Fade Toggle (5:31) Play Video
71 Slide Down (6:34) Play Video
72 Slide Up (3:23) Play Video
73 Slide Toggle (5:07) Play Video
74 Stop (5:33) Play Video
75 Delay (5:07) Play Video
76 Gallery Fading Effect (6:40) Play Video
77 Gallery Fading Effect (6:59) Play Video
78 append (7:06) Play Video
79 appendTo (4:58) Play Video
80 clone (2:12) Play Video
81 width/height (6:02) Play Video
82 width/height (6:01) Play Video
83 scrollTop (6:29) Play Video
84 Adding to a dropdown menu (6:36) Play Video
85 Placing DIV in very center of window (5:56) Play Video
86 Placing DIV in very center of window (6:05) Play Video
87 Minimum text field length (6:41) Play Video
88 Minimum text field length (6:21) Play Video
89 Scroll to top (9:51) Play Video
90 Enabling checkbox after scrolling (6:03) Play Video
91 Enabling checkbox after scrolling (6:03) Play Video
92 inArray (8:28) Play Video
93 each (8:35) Play Video
94 now (5:30) Play Video
95 Days until event (8:44) Play Video
96 Load file (8:32) Play Video
97 GET HTTP Request (6:53) Play Video
98 GET HTTP Request (6:42) Play Video
99 POST HTTP Request (9:05) Play Video
100 Other callback functions (7:49) Play Video
101 AJAX Load (5:57) Play Video
102 AJAX Send Data (4:32) Play Video
103 AJAX Callback Handlers (3:43) Play Video
104 Changing AJAX data type (3:24) Play Video
105 AJAX Status Codes (5:24) Play Video
106 Email validation (6:28) Play Video
107 Email validation 2 (6:24) Play Video
108 Email validation 3 (6:20) Play Video
109 Email validation 4 (5:34) Play Video
110 Email validation 5 (4:57) Play Video
111 Updating database table values 1 (6:10) Play Video
112 Updating database table values 2 (6:41) Play Video
113 Updating database table values 3 (6:19) Play Video
114 Updating database table values 4 (6:08) Play Video
115 Introduction to Plugins (8:42) Play Video
116 Show password plugin (6:15) Play Video
117 Show password plugin 2 (6:18) Play Video
118 Creating a basic plugin (6:16) Play Video
119 Creating a basic plugin 2 (6:57) Play Video
120 Creating a basic plugin 3 (6:42) Play Video
121 Highlight search plugin (7:26) Play Video
122 Highlight search plugin 2 (7:36) Play Video
123 Passing options to plugin (5:19) Play Video
124 Passing options to plugin 2 (5:39) Play Video
125 Plugin callback functions (7:09) Play Video
126 Plugin callback functions 2 (7:08) Play Video
127 Creating a hover text plugin (7:29) Play Video
128 Creating a hover text plugin 2 (7:06) Play Video
129 Creating a hover text plugin 3 (6:38) Play Video
130 Creating a hover text plugin 4 (5:52) Play Video
131 Creating a hover text plugin 5 (5:51) Play Video
132 Creating a hover text plugin 6 (5:42) Play Video
133 Creating a day/hour/min/sec countdown plugin (6:21) Play Video
134 Creating a day/hour/min/sec countdown plugin 2 (5:58) Play Video
135 Creating a day/hour/min/sec countdown plugin 3 (6:03) Play Video
136 Creating a day/hour/min/sec countdown plugin 4 (6:07) Play Video
137 Creating a day/hour/min/sec countdown plugin 5 (6:30) Play Video
138 Creating a day/hour/min/sec countdown plugin 6 (6:33) Play Video
139 Introduction to jQuery UI (3:23) Play Video
140 Installing jQuery UI 2 (5:38) Play Video
141 Draggable (7:12) Play Video
142 Draggable 2 (7:36) Play Video
143 Draggable 3 (8:04) Play Video
144 Droppable (6:19) Play Video
145 Droppable 2 (6:05) Play Video
146 Droppable 3 (6:44) Play Video
147 Sortable (7:05) Play Video
148 Sortable 2 (7:45) Play Video
149 Resizable (6:31) Play Video
150 Resizable 2 (6:38) Play Video
151 Resizable 3 (6:27) Play Video
152 Accordion (5:50) Play Video
153 Accordion 2 (5:39) Play Video
154 Datepicker (5:25) Play Video
155 Datepicker 2 (5:52) Play Video
156 Dialog (6:14) Play Video
157 Dialog 2 (6:54) Play Video
158 Dialog 3 (6:33) Play Video
159 Progressbar (5:25) Play Video
160 Progressbar 2 (5:04) Play Video
161 Slider (6:46) Play Video
162 Slider 2 (7:08) Play Video
163 Tabs (6:14) Play Video
164 Tabs 2 (6:45) Play Video
165 Tabs 3 (6:15) Play Video
166 Drag and Drop Lists (7:26) Play Video
167 Drag and Drop Lists 2 (7:05) Play Video
168 Check if a Username is Available (5:52) Play Video
169 Check if a Username is Available 2 (5:52) Play Video
170 Check if a Username is Available 3 (5:55) Play Video
171 Sliding down message (7:54) Play Video
172 Sliding down message 2 (8:28) Play Video
173 Countdown to redirect (6:30) Play Video
174 Countdown to redirect 2 (7:07) Play Video
175 Loading content with AJAX and fade effect (5:58) Play Video
176 Loading content with AJAX and fade effect 2 (5:52) Play Video
177 Loading content with AJAX and fade effect 3 (6:06) Play Video
178 Instant search (6:00) Play Video
179 Instant search 2 (6:41) Play Video
180 Instant search 3 (6:17) Play Video
181 Instant search 4 (6:53) Play Video
182 Users online sample application (6:47) Play Video
183 Users online sample application 2 (6:18) Play Video
184 Users online sample application 3 (6:46) Play Video
185 Users online sample application 4 (8:20) Play Video
186 Users online sample application 5 (6:58) Play Video
187 Multiple file upload (6:37) Play Video
188 Multiple file upload 2 (7:05) Play Video
189 DIV that follows down screen (5:04) Play Video
190 DIV that follows down screen 2 (4:58) Play Video
191 DIV that follows down screen 3 (4:53) Play Video
192 Textarea emoticon text inserter (6:40) Play Video
193 Textarea emoticon text inserter 2 (6:58) Play Video
194 Textarea emoticon text inserter 3 (7:13) Play Video
195 Show/hide password in field (6:00) Play Video
196 Show/hide password in field 2 (6:14) Play Video
197 Show/hide password in field 3 (7:34) Play Video
198 Show/hide password in field 4 (7:21) Play Video
199 Submit a form on element change (6:17) Play Video
200 Submit a form on element change 2 (5:54) Play Video

Comments

There are no comments. Be the first to post one.
  Post comment as a guest user.
Click to login or register:
Your name:
Your email:
(will not appear)
Your comment:
(max. 1000 characters)
Are you human? (Sorry)
 
Disclaimer:
CosmoLearning is promoting these materials solely for nonprofit educational purposes, and to recognize contributions made by The New Boston (thenewboston) to online education. We do not host or upload any copyrighted materials, including videos hosted on video websites like YouTube*, unless with explicit permission from the author(s). All intellectual property rights are reserved to thenewboston and involved parties. CosmoLearning is not endorsed by thenewboston, and we are not affiliated with them, unless otherwise specified. Any questions, claims or concerns regarding this content should be directed to their creator(s).

*If any embedded videos constitute copyright infringement, we strictly recommend contacting the website hosts directly to have such videos taken down. In such an event, these videos will no longer be playable on CosmoLearning or other websites.